MAG, SOCOM Confrontation and SOCOM 4 going offline Jan. 2014
Sony Computer Entertainment announced it will be taking three PlayStation 3 games — MAG, SOCOM: U.S. Navy SEALs Confrontation and SOCOM 4: U.S. Navy SEALs. — offline early next year and ending their multiplayer service.
The three titles will have their multiplayer support come to an end Jan. 28, 2014, according to a tweet from the official PlayStation account.
Slant Six Games' SOCOM Confrontation was released for PS3 in 2008. MAG and SOCOM 4, developed by Zipper Interactive, were released in 2010 and 2011, respectively. Zipper closed its doors in 2012.
